Just what is an Auto Hoover Robot?

To understand the appeal of auto hoover robotics, it's important to understand what they are and how they work. Essentially, an auto hoover robot is a compact, disc-shaped home appliance packed with technology. The crucial elements that enable their autonomous operation include:

  • Sensors: A network of sensors is important for navigation. These can consist of:
  • Navigation Systems: The "brain" of the robot, these systems determine the cleaning path and make sure efficient coverage. Common navigation techniques include:
    • Random Bounce: Basic models move arbitrarily, altering direction when coming across barriers.
    • Methodical Navigation: More innovative designs use algorithms, frequently involving mapping innovation, to clean in arranged patterns (like rows or grids) for thorough protection.
    • Lidar (Light Detection and Ranging): Uses lasers to create in-depth maps of the home, allowing for highly efficient and organized cleaning courses.
    • Visual SLAM (Simultaneous Localization and Mapping): Utilizes electronic cameras to visually map the environment, frequently combined with other sensing unit data for improved navigation.
  • Cleaning System: This typically comprises:
    • Brushes: Rotating brushes, frequently side brushes and a primary brush roll, loosen up dirt and debris from the floor.
    • Suction Motor: Creates suction to raise dirt and dust into the dustbin.
    • Filter System: Traps dust and irritants, frequently consisting of HEPA filters for enhanced air quality.
  • Battery and Charging System: Powered by rechargeable batteries, auto hoover robots instantly return to their charging dock when battery levels are low, ensuring they are always ready for the next cleaning cycle.

Picking the Right Auto Hoover Robot: Key Features to Consider

With a broad variety of auto hoover robots available in the market, choosing the ideal one for your needs can feel frustrating. Understanding the crucial functions and considering your specific requirements is essential for making an informed choice.

Here are vital functions to evaluate:

  1. Navigation and Mapping Capabilities: Consider the kind of navigation system. For easy designs, a random bounce or methodical navigation system might suffice. For larger homes or complex designs, designs with Lidar or visual SLAM deal remarkable protection and effectiveness. Mapping features also permit selective space cleaning and virtual borders.
  2. Suction Power: Different designs use varying levels of suction power. Residences with carpets or carpets, specifically high-pile carpets, will gain from robots with stronger suction to successfully eliminate embedded dirt and pet hair.
  3. Battery Life and Charging: Evaluate battery life based on the size of your home and cleaning needs. Think about charging time and whether the robot automatically goes back to its charging dock. Some models offer fast charging or the capability to resume cleaning after charging.
  4. Brush Types and Cleaning System: Look at the brush types and configuration. Side brushes are necessary for edge cleaning, while the primary brush roll is crucial for upseting debris. Consider brush types created for particular floor types (e.g., soft brushes for tough floorings, stiffer brushes for carpets).
  5. Filter System and Allergen Control: If allergies or breathing level of sensitivities are a concern, focus on designs with HEPA filters. These filters trap a greater percentage of great particles compared to standard filters.
  6. Smart Features and Connectivity: Determine if features like Wi-Fi connectivity, app control, scheduling, voice assistant integration, and space mapping are important to you. These features improve benefit and modification.
  7. Mopping Functionality: Some auto hoover robotics use a mopping function in addition to vacuuming. These hybrid designs can be hassle-free for homes with tough floorings, however consider their mopping capabilities and limitations compared to devoted mopping robotics or manual mopping.
  8. Dustbin Capacity and Maintenance: Consider the dustbin size in relation to your home and cleaning frequency. Larger dustbins need less frequent emptying. Also, examine the ease of dustbin emptying, brush cleaning, and filter replacement, as regular upkeep is important for optimal efficiency.
  9. Sound Level: Check the noise level score if quiet operation is a concern, especially for families with young kids, family pets, or noise level of sensitivities.
  10. Pet Hair Handling: If you have animals, try to find models specifically designed for pet hair elimination. These often feature tangle-free brush rolls, more powerful suction, and bigger dustbins to successfully manage pet fur.
  11. Spending plan: Auto hoover robotics range in cost from economical to high-end models. Determine your spending plan and focus on the functions that are most essential to you within that rate range.

Keeping Your Auto Hoover Robot for Longevity and Performance

To ensure your auto hoover robot runs efficiently and lasts for many years to come, routine upkeep is essential. Simple upkeep jobs can substantially extend the life-span and keep the cleaning efficiency of your robotic companion.

Here are key maintenance steps:

  • Empty the Dustbin Regularly: This is the most crucial maintenance job. Empty the dustbin after each cleaning cycle or as required to prevent it from becoming full and impeding suction power.
  • Clean Brushes and Brush Roll: Regularly examine and clean up the side brushes and main brush roll. Eliminate any twisted hair, threads, or particles that can build up and restrain their rotation.
  • Change Filters as Recommended: Filters, specifically HEPA filters, require to be changed periodically according to the manufacturer's directions. This guarantees optimum filtration and air quality.
  • Clean Sensors: Gently clean the sensing units with a soft, dry fabric to remove dust or debris that can impact navigation and barrier detection.
  • Examine and Clean Wheels: Ensure the wheels are free of debris and can rotate efficiently.
  • Inspect for Wear and Tear: Periodically look for any indications of wear and tear on brushes, wheels, or other components. Change parts as needed to maintain optimal efficiency.
  • Battery Care: While auto hoover robotics are designed for automatic charging, avoid consistently draining pipes the battery entirely, as this can shorten its life expectancy. Follow the manufacturer's suggestions for battery care.

Often Asked Questions (FAQs) about Auto Hoover Robots

Q1: Are auto hoover robots efficient on all floor types?A1: Most auto hoover robotics are developed to deal with a range of floor types, consisting of wood, tile, laminate, and low-pile carpets. Nevertheless, efficiency on high-pile carpets may vary. Inspect product specifications for advised floor types and consider suction power for carpet cleaning.

Q2: Can auto hoover robotics deal with pet hair effectively?A2: Yes, many auto hoover robots are particularly created for pet hair removal. Try to find models with functions like tangle-free brush rolls, strong suction, and HEPA filters to effectively handle pet fur.

Q3: How long do auto hoover robot batteries generally last?A3: Battery life differs depending upon the model and usage, but a lot of robots offer cleaning times varying from 60 to 120 minutes on a single charge. Advanced models with larger batteries can clean for longer durations.

Q4: Are auto hoover robots noisy?A4: Noise levels differ. Lots of models operate at noise levels similar to or quieter than a typical conversation, making them less disruptive than standard vacuums. Inspect noise level ratings if peaceful operation is an issue.

Q5: How often do I need to clear the dustbin and keep the robot?A5: Empty the dustbin after each cleaning cycle or as required. Tidy brushes and replace filters routinely according to the maker's guidelines, normally every few weeks or months, to maintain optimal efficiency.

Q6: Can auto hoover robots browse around furnishings and challenges?A6: Yes, auto hoover robotics are geared up with sensing units to spot and navigate around furnishings and challenges. Advanced models with mapping innovation can find out the design of your home and tidy more methodically.

Q7: Are auto hoover robotics costly?A7: The cost of auto hoover robots ranges from affordable to high-end models. Rates depend on features, navigation innovation, brand, and abilities. There are alternatives readily available to match various budget plans.

Q8: Can I control my auto hoover robot from another location?A8: Many modern auto hoover robots with Wi-Fi connectivity can be controlled remotely via mobile phone apps. This permits scheduling, starting/stopping cleaning cycles, keeping an eye on development, and accessing other smart functions from anywhere.

Q9: Can auto hoover robotics mop in addition to vacuum?A9: Some hybrid auto hoover robots provide a mopping function. These models can be hassle-free for light mopping of difficult floors, however they might not replace devoted mopping robots or manual mopping for deep cleaning.

Q10: What occurs if the auto hoover robot gets stuck?A10: Most auto hoover robots have challenge avoidance functions and are designed to get themselves unstuck in lots of scenarios. However, in rare cases, they may get stuck. Some designs send notices by means of app if they experience concerns or need assistance. It's suggested to clear mess and wires from the floor to lessen the possibilities of getting stuck.
